 Flood Relief Measures With Over 20,000 Sri Lankan Troops

Immediate relief is provided by more than 20,000 Sri Lankan troops, to people affected by the severe weather and floods in the island, over the past few days.

Military spokesperson Brigadier Ruwan Wanigasooriya was quoted by the Lanka Page web site, as saying that immediate relief measures are continuing with the coordination of the DMC Task force.

The task force is headed by the Secretary to the President Lalith Weeratunga and consists of Secretary to the Ministry of Disaster Management, Secretary to the Ministry of Public Administration, the Chief of Defence Staff, Tri Services Commanders and the Inspector General of Police.
